Aliform,
Which country are you looking at flying the approach in???
In OZ we have been operating GPS approaches which can be coupled for some time. These include helo approaches to a point in space. They are a whole lot better than a NDB approach on a thundery night. Various system requirements etc can be found on the OZ CASA web site.
